People may also believe that increased online access to crime data means that an area is unsafe. Statistics shared through the City of Chandler Police Department: Keeping Justice in the Valley can raise awareness, but they do not tell the whole story. Growth and population density naturally lead to more reported incidents, even when crime rates remain stable or decline. Understanding context is essential to avoid misinterpreting numbers and to support reasoned public discourse.
